Warriors v Crusaders: Teams

Wigan are looking to end of run of three successive Super League defeats and are able to name Cameron Phelps and Gareth Hock in the initial 19-man squad.
Phelps should return from a hamstring injury while Hock faces a late fitness test after picking up a knock in last week's defeat to St Helens.
George Carmont is in the squad but is thought unlikely to be fit for match-day, while Harrison Hansen is also missing with a dead leg.
However, Phil Bailey (ankle) and Joel Tomkins (head) have overcome knocks from Monday's defeat at Catalans.
Crusaders are again without captain Jace van Dijk and full-back Tony Duggan (ankle) is not yet fit to return.
Matty Smith, Geraint Davies and Mark Lennon also remain sidelined for the foreseeable future.
Lincoln Withers is back in contention after a knee injury and Damien Quinn becomes the first player to reach 100 Crusaders appearances.
Wigan squad: Roberts, Carmont, Richards, Smith, Leuluai, Fielden, Riddell, Paleaaesina, Hock, Bailey, O'Loughlin, J. Tomkins, Coley, McIlorum, Prescott, Phelps, Gleeson, S. Tomkins, Ainscough.
Celtic Crusaders squad: Beasley, Blackwood, Bryant, Budworth, Chalk, Chan, Dalle Cort, Dyer, Flower, Hannay, A. James, J. James, Lupton, O'Hara, Peek, Quinn, Tangata-Toa, Mapp, Withers.
